Procedure for tests above the withstand level 6 O BSI 24 May 2002 Page 4 EN 60230:2002 IMPULSE TESTS ON CABLES AND THEIR ACCESSORIES SECTION ONE - G

19、ENERAL 1. Object and scope 1.1 The object of this Recominendation is to lay down the conditions and procedure for carrying out impulse tests on cables anid their accessories, with a view to rationalizing the practice in different laboratories, and thus to facilitate valid comparisons between the res

20、ults obtained on cables made to different specifications. 1.2 This Recommendation applies solely to the methods of carrying out the tests as such, independently of the problem of selecting the test levels to be specified. 1.3 It is applicable to high-voltage cables of all types. 1.4 The Recommendati

21、on is divided into three sections. In Section One, the characteristics and state of the test installation and those parts of the procedure which are common to withstand tests and tests above the withstand level are described. Section Two describes the procedure for carrying out withstand tests. Sect

22、ion Three of this Recommendation describes the procedure for carrying out tests above the withstand lleve1 and is intended for research purposes. 2. Characteristics of the test installation to be subjected to the tests 2.1 All samples of cable to be included in the test installation shall have been

23、subjected to the bending operation included as part of the bending test in the relevant I E C Recommendation. Note. - Different mechanical operations may be appropriate to cables for special conditions of service, e.g. submarine cables. These should be the subject of agreement between the purchaser

24、and the manufacturer, if not described in the relevant I E C liecommendation. 2.2 The length of the sample taken shall be such that the length of cable between the lower parts of the sealing ends is at least 5 m, if the test installation is not intended to include any other accessory. 2.3 Where one

25、joint is included in the test installation, the minimum length of freecable, between the joint and the bottom of each sealing end, shall be 5 m. Where more than one joint is included, the same requirement shall be observed and in addition there shall be a minimum length of 3 m of free cable between

26、successive joints. 3. State of the test installation The test installation shall be maintained under the following conditions : 3.1 Pressure conditions For gas-pressure and oil-filled cables, the pressure shall be adjusted in accordance with the relevant I E C Recommendation. 3.2 Temperature conditi

27、ons The temperature conditions and the method of temperature measurement shall be as described in the relevant I E C Recornmendation, but other methods of temperature measurement may be used by agreement between the purchaser and the manufacturer. O BSI 24 May 2002 Page 5 EN 60230:2002 4. 5. 6. Shap

28、e of the impulse waves: The impulse waves applied shall have a wave front of a duration between 1 ps and 5 ps, and a duration to half the peak value of 50 f 10 ps. They shall further comply with I E C Publication 60, High-voltage Test Techniques, where applicable. Calibration of impulse generator Im

29、mediately before cir during the period when the temperature of the cable is maintained at a constant value, preparatory to the application of the impulses, the generator shall be calibrated, with positive polarity, under the following conditions : Both ends of the test assembly shall be connected to

30、 the impulse generator. A measuring sphere- gap and an oscillograph, with its associated voltage divider, shall be connected in parallel and remain so connected throughout the test. For every setting of the sphere-gap, the charging voltage of the generator shall be so adjusted as to give 50% flashov

31、er of the gap (see Sub-clause 6.3.1.2 of I E C Publication 60) and an oscillo- gram of the impulse voltage shall be taken. This procedure shall be carried out for at least three .different settings of the sphere-gap. The settings shall be so selected that their 50 % flashover voltages are approximat

32、ely 50 %, 615 % and 80 % of the test level specified. A curve showing the charging voltage as a function of the sphere-gap flashover voltage shall be drawn for this positive polarity. This curve, which should be a straight line, shall be extrapolated to determine the charging voltage necessary to ob

33、tain the specified level with positive polarity. The ratio of the voltage divider shall be so selected for this polarity as to take into account the maximum flashover voltages for the sphere-gap and the voltage oscillograms that have to be obtained. This value for the ratio of the voltage divider sh

34、all be used for all the oscillograms taken in the course of the series of tests with this polarity. Other peak voltage measuring devices may be used in place of, or in addition to, the sphere-gap, but such devices shall comply with I E C Publication 60. Thus, if a peak voltage measuring device is us

35、ed in addition to an oscillograph, in conjunction with the voltage divider, and this instrument and the divider both comply with I E C Publication 60, the impulse generator may be calibrated by adjusting the charging voltage to give approximately 50 %, 65 % and 80 % of the test level specified. SECT

36、ION Two - WITHSTAND TESTS Application of the impulse; at the level speciied 6.1 With the sphere-gap setting increased so that no flashover occurs across the gap, and with the cable maintained at the required temperature, the test installation shall be subjected to a series of 10 positive impulses at

37、 the voltage specified. The time interval between two successive impulses shall be just sucient to ensure that the impulse generator is charged at the correct voltage. 6.2 Immediately after the aplplication of the 10 positive impulses, the generator shall be re-calibrated for negative polarity under

38、 the conditions specified in Clause 5, and a series of 10 negative impulses of the same specified voltage shall then be applied to the test assembly. 6.3 Oscillograms shall be taken of at least the first and tenth impulses in each series. The oscillograms shall include a timing 0sc:illation. 6.4 The

39、 ambient temperature, the cable temperature and, where applicable, the gas or oil pressure, shall be checked during the test. O BSI 24 May 2002 Page 6 EN 60230:2002 SECTION THREE - TESTS ABOVE THE WITHSTAND LEVEL 7. Application of impulse test above the specified withstand level and omission of powe

40、r-frequency test 7.1 When, for research purposes, impulse tests to levels above the withstand level are made, the procedure given below is recommended. 7.2 In this case, the power-frequency test at ambient temperature, included in I E C Publications 141-1, 141-2 and 141-3, Tests on Cil-iled and Gas-

41、pressure Cables and their Accessories may be omitted, provided that there is no doubt that the test instailation has successfully passed the impulse withstand voltage test. If the last oscillogram does not show this clearly, further impulse voltages may be applied at withstand level to obtain a good

42、 oscillogram. 8. Procedure for tests above the withstand level 8.1 With the temperature conditions as speded in Sub-clause 3.2, impulses shall be applied in the following sequence : 1) 10 negative impulses at withstand voltage plus approximately 5 %; 2) 5 positive impulses, the first at 50 % of the

43、value used for I) and the remainder at progressively increasing values up to 85 % of the value used for 1) ; 3) 10 positive impulses at withstand voltage plus approximately 5 %; 4) 10 positive impulses at withstand voltage plus approximately 10%; 5) 5 negative impulses, the first at 50 % of the valu

44、e used for 4) and the remainder at progressively increasing values up to 85 % of the value used for 4); 6) 10 negative impulses at withstand voltage plus approximately 10 %. 8.2 The sequence speded in Sub-clause 8.1 shall be repeated, the test voltage being increased in steps of approximately 5 %. T

45、hus, steps 7) and 9) will be at withstand voltage plus approximately 15 %; steps 10) and 12) at withstand voltage plus 20%; and so on. 8.3 The best shall continue until the desired voltage is reached, or until breakdown occurs. 8.4 Oscillograms shall be taken of at least the first and tenth impulses

46、 of each senes. 8.5 In general, no recalibration of the generator is necessary throughout this series of tests and the voltage can be determined by extrapolation from the original calibration. When, however, the margin between the test voltage and the maximum voltage used for the original calibratio

47、n is considered too large for accurate resulk;, a fresh calibration may be necessary. (See Sub-clause 6.2.5.2 of I E C Publication 60.)
